Plain-English plan summary

According to public Form 5500 filings published through the U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) Employee Benefits Security Administration (EBSA) via the EFAST2 system, Anchor Bay Clinic Family Medical Center P.C. Employees' 401(K) Plan And Trust is a benefit plan reported by Anchor Bay Clinic Family Medical Center P.C. under EIN 38-2376533 and plan number 001. The latest loaded filing year is 2023. The filing reports 20 participants and $2,677,148 in end-of-year plan assets, where available in the loaded dataset.
